1. Navagio Beach – Zakynthos, Greece
Often called Shipwreck Beach, Navagio Beach is tucked between towering limestone cliffs and accessible only by boat.
Why travelers love it:
- Electric blue water
- Dramatic cliff views
- One of Europe’s most photogenic beaches

2. Playa del Amor (Hidden Beach) – Mexico
Located inside a collapsed volcanic crater in the Marieta Islands, this beach looks like something from another planet.
Highlights:
- Natural skylight opening
- Rare wildlife
- Protected marine reserve

3. Whitehaven Beach – Whitsundays, Australia
Whitehaven Beach features 98% pure silica sand, giving it a bright white appearance that feels soft and cool underfoot.
Why it’s special:
- One of the whitest beaches in the world
- Located in the Great Barrier Reef
- Incredible aerial views at Hill Inlet

4. Anse Source d’Argent – Seychelles
One of the most photographed beaches in the world, yet still peaceful thanks to its island location.
Features:
- Giant granite boulders
- Shallow turquoise lagoon
- Coral reef snorkeling

5. Cala Macarella – Menorca, Spain
This hidden Mediterranean cove is surrounded by pine forests and limestone cliffs.
Best for:
- Swimming
- Paddleboarding
- Sunset views
